The Ritz Hotel in Paris claims to have created this cocktail in the early 20th century. The potent combination of Cognac and orange-flavored liqueur shaken until ice cold with lemon juice is a timeless classic. Ingredients:
1 teaspoon white sugar |
2 fluid ounces cognac |
1 fluid ounce orange-flavored liqueur (such as cointreau®) |
1/2 fluid ounce lemon juice |
1 cup ice cubes |
Directions:
1. Sprinkle sugar on a small plate. Lightly wet half the rim of of a coupe glass with a damp paper towel. Dip the moistened rim in sugar to coat. Set the glass in the refrigerator to chill. 2. Combine Cognac, orange-flavored liqueur, and lemon juice in a cocktail shaker. Add ice, cover, and shake until chilled. Strain into the chilled, sugar-rimmed coupe. |
